DAIRY PRODUCE.
MARKETS STEAD V. The New Zealand Loan and Mercantile Agency Co., has received the following ckble from its London Irouse, dated August 31:— Butter: 109 sto llOs per cwt. Cheese: White G2s to 63s per cwt; coloured, 56s 6d to 575. Market steady. Messrs Joseph Nathan and Co. have received the following cable from their London principals, Messrs Trengrouse and Nathan, Tooley Street, dated August 110 s per cwt. Cheese: White, 62s 6d per cwt; coloured, 575. Both markets steady. Messrs Newdick Bros. (Whiteley, Muir and Zwanenberg) report: Butter: New Zealand, 110 s per cwt; Australian, 103 s. Cheese: White, 635; coloured, 58s.
